COVID-19 Vaccine Availability in Brazoria County
 
Post Date: 01/05/2021 6:00 PM
 
In Brazoria County, over 80 facilities are enrolled with the State to receive and administer the COVID-19 vaccine. County officials encourage eligible residents (those that fall into phase 1A and Phase 1B) to watch for information from local pharmacies, physician’s offices, urgent care facilities, etc., for dates the COVID-19 vaccine will be available at these locations. Brazoria County will post COVID-19 vaccine information and updates on the Brazoria County website www.brazoriacountytx .gov/home as the COVID-19 vaccine becomes available through
the County. CDC has provided information on who gets vaccinated first; when the COVID-19 vaccine is limited, here is the link to that information www.cdc.gov/coronavi rus/2019-ncov/vaccin es/recommendations.h tml
